The Kebbi State University of Science and Technology (KSUSTA) is a state-owned university in Aliero, Kebbi State, Nigeria. KSUSTA offers programmes in agriculture and sciences, among others. Founded in 2006, it was the 79th university in Nigeria.

Kebbi State University of Science and Technology (KSUSTA) JAMB CUT OFF MARK

The management of the Kebbi State University of Science and Technology has released the cut-off mark for the 2024/2025 admission exercise. KSUSTA general Post-UTME minimum cut-off mark for the 2024/2025 academic session is 140 and Above.

This will be the JAMB score that will be used for admission into KSUSTA for the 2024/2025 academic session.

Kebbi State University of Science and Technology does not really have a specific cut off mark for courses.

This means that KSUSTA cut off mark is 140 for the 2024/2025 academic session’s admission exercise

KSUSTA Post UTME Eligibility:

  • Candidates who score exactly or above the required cut off mark.
  • Candidates who chose Kebbi State University of Science and Technology as their preferred choice of institution during the UTME Registration.
  • Candidates are also required to obtain the required O’level credits for their programmes as specified in JAMB Brochure.
  • Candidate must be at least 16 (Sixteen) of age.
  • Interested Candidates who did not choose Kebbi State University of Science and Technology during the UTME Registration but wish to study in the University, should change to the KSUSTA via JAMB website.
